Soya, the offline reader for four language ladders

Soya rewrites links and book titles into level-appropriate Chinese, Japanese, or Korean, with readings, word explanations, lessons, and practice games.

Why it surfaced

This is unusually concrete language-learning software: 406 lessons, more than 26,000 graded words, five offline games, and separate HSK, JLPT, and TOPIK pathways are bundled into the download. The homepage says the app is free, requires no account, subscription, ads, or trackers, and is currently in App Store and Google Play review.
